WVU Parkersburg to present "The Compleat Works of Wllm Shakspr (abridged)."
CONTACT: Carson Soelberg, theatre director, 304-424-8295.
F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ASEMacbeth? Hamlet? Lear? Otello? R & J? All in one night? Insanity, you say? But you’ll see all the works of “The Bard” in a single evening when West Virginia University at Parkersburg's Theatre Department presents "The Compleat Works of Wllm Shakspr (abridged)," on Feb. 24-26.
Curtain time is 8 p.m., Feb 24 and 25 and 2 p.m., Feb. 26 in the college's multi-purpose room. Admission is free. Written by the Reduced Shakespeare Company, the production features three cast members: students Brandi Wolfe, Dallas Zickefoose, and Chad Goode.
"For those whose only familiarity with Shakespeare is the distant memory of a high school English class, the evening of hilarity makes these classics easily accessible as rap, football, and cooking shows are featured to update the works," noted Carson Soelberg, director. "Those with a stronger Shakespearean background will catch even more of the many inside jokes and see 'The Bard' in an entirely different light," he added.Additional information is available by contacting Soelberg at 424-8295.
